MR Engineering

The CMRR Engineering group develops novel RF coils and Antenna arrays and builds the most advanced Ultra High Field Magnet (UHF) frontend technology required for CMRR’s highest field imaging systems in support of the most demanding UHF experiments in the Center and beyond. This requires development of extensive RF Safety evaluation methodology and MR system engineering. These efforts have  resulted in systems with up to 128 receiver channels and the ability to test RF coils in a dedicated RF Safety lab. One other aspect of RF safety research conducted in CMRR is related to imaging implants. Utilizing advanced multi-channel transmit systems available in CMRR, implant-friendly RF excitation solutions are used to mitigate the interactions between metallic devices and RF fields in MRI at 3T and beyond.
